all lists on lists.proxmox.com
 help / color / mirror / Atom feed
From: Fabian Ebner <f.ebner@proxmox.com>
To: pbs-devel@lists.proxmox.com
Subject: Re: [pbs-devel] [PATCH-SERIES v4] APT repositories API/UI
Date: Mon, 10 May 2021 07:54:56 +0200	[thread overview]
Message-ID: <cf6bd732-179a-1fec-7835-6dabd77393a8@proxmox.com> (raw)
In-Reply-To: <20210402112051.14628-1-f.ebner@proxmox.com>

Ping

Am 02.04.21 um 13:20 schrieb Fabian Ebner:
> List the configured repositories and have some basic checks for them.
> 
> The plan is to use perlmod to make the Rust implementation available for PVE+PMG
> as well.
> 
> 
> Changes from v3:
>      * incorporate Fabian G.'s feedback:
>          * switch to a per-file approach
>          * check for official host names
>          * fix case-sensitivity issue for .sources keys
>          * include digests
>      * fix write issue when there are no components (in case of an absolute suite)
>      * add more tests
> 
> 
> Still missing (intended as followups):
>      * Upgrade suite/distribuiton button to be used before major release
>        upgrades (but it's really simply to add that now).
>      * perlmod magic and integration in PVE and PMG.
> 
> 
> Changes v2 -> v3:
>      * incorporate Wolfgang's feedback
>      * improve main warning's UI
> 
> Changes v1 -> v2:
>      * Perl -> Rust
>      * PVE -> PBS
>      * Don't rely on regexes for parsing.
>      * Add writer and tests.
>      * UI: pin warnings to the repository they're for.
>      * Keep order of options consistent with configuration.
>      * Smaller things noted on the individual patches.
> 
> proxmox-apt:
> 
> Fabian Ebner (4):
>    initial commit
>    add files for Debian packaging
>    add functions to check for Proxmox repositories
>    add check_repositories function
> 
> 
> proxmox-backup:
> 
> Fabian Ebner (4):
>    depend on new proxmox-apt crate
>    api: apt: add repositories call
>    ui: add panel for APT repositories
>    api: apt: add check_repositories_call
> 
>   Cargo.toml                  |   1 +
>   debian/control              |   1 +
>   src/api2/node/apt.rs        | 149 +++++++++++++++++++++++++++++++++++-
>   www/ServerAdministration.js |   8 ++
>   4 files changed, 158 insertions(+), 1 deletion(-)
> 
> 
> proxmox-widget-toolkit:
> 
> Fabian Ebner (2):
>    add UI for APT repositories
>    APT repositories: add warnings
> 
>   src/Makefile                |   1 +
>   src/node/APTRepositories.js | 415 ++++++++++++++++++++++++++++++++++++
>   2 files changed, 416 insertions(+)
>   create mode 100644 src/node/APTRepositories.js
> 




  parent reply	other threads:[~2021-05-10  5:55 UTC|newest]

Thread overview: 13+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2021-04-02 11:20 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 proxmox-apt 01/10] initial commit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 proxmox-apt 02/10] add files for Debian packaging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 proxmox-apt 03/10] add functions to check for Proxmox repositories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 proxmox-apt 04/10] add check_repositories function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 proxmox-backup 05/10] depend on new proxmox-apt crate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 proxmox-backup 06/10] api: apt: add repositories call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 proxmox-backup 07/10] ui: add panel for APT repositories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 proxmox-backup 08/10] api: apt: add check_repositories_call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 widget-toolkit 09/10] add UI for APT repositories Fabian Ebner
2021-04-02 11:20 ` [pbs-devel] [PATCH v4 widget-toolkit 10/10] APT repositories: add warnings Fabian Ebner
2021-05-10  5:54 ` Fabian Ebner [this message]
2021-05-10 13:22   ` [pbs-devel] [PATCH-SERIES v4] APT repositories API/UI Thomas Lamprecht

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=cf6bd732-179a-1fec-7835-6dabd77393a8@proxmox.com \
    --to=f.ebner@proxmox.com \
    --cc=pbs-devel@lists.proxmox.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.
Service provided by Proxmox Server Solutions GmbH | Privacy | Legal